Transaction 1243977d584df2340852bff8b9661f4891072135aae01b637612894483a969c6
1 Input
1 Output
-
1243977d584df2340852bff8b9661f4891072135aae01b637612894483a969c6:0
- value
- 19684060
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 d37a2e46cf46d564be68eaeef50700a4d8f704cb OP_EQUALVERIFY OP_CHECKSIG
- address
- 1LHBwkCXC7GcVP2nSgVGpjPGmd97cmirty